The Graettinger-Terril/Ruthven-Ayrshire Titans will challenge the Marcus-Meriden-Cleghorn/Remsen-Union Royals at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Given that the two teams suffered a loss in their last games, they both have a little extra motivation heading into this game.
Graettinger-Terril/Ruthven-Ayrshire came up short against Sioux Central on Friday, falling 52-29. The contest marked the Titans' lowest-scoring match so far this season.
Meanwhile, Marcus-Meriden-Cleghorn/Remsen-Union was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their sixth straight defeat. They took a 44-37 hit to the loss column at the hands of Akron-Westfield.
Graettinger-Terril/Ruthven-Ayrshire's loss ended a five-game streak of away wins and brought them to 9-12. As for Marcus-Meriden-Cleghorn/Remsen-Union,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-19.
Graettinger-Terril/Ruthven-Ayrshire was able to grind out a solid victory over Marcus-Meriden-Cleghorn/Remsen-Union when the teams last played back in February of 2024, winning 56-49.
